About the Book

A thorough introduction that lessens the learning curve to building sites with Drupal 7Drupal 7 is the latest version of the free, open source content management system Drupal. A powerful content management system and framework Drupal has an unfortunate reputation of having a steep learning curve. This guide to Drupal 7 methodically demystifies Drupal and shortening the learning curve.Author Jacob Redding is deeply embedded in the Drupal community, and walks first-time Drupal developers through the installation and configuration of a Drupal system. In-depth information on key areas of Drupal explore the Drupal hook system, Drupal's theming layer, and Drupal's API. You'll also get sample code, and lessons that guide you through various aspects of Drupal. * Introduces you to every aspect of Drupal 7 * Demystifies key areas of Drupal and shortens the learning curve for even the most novice beginner * Features lessons and sample code that offer extra insight into a Drupal web site * Exploring simple single website installations and more advanced multiple site installations that share users and/or content. * Addresses how to use Drupal's theming layer to your advantage. With this comprehensive and clear book by your side, you will quickly learn to leverage Drupal's impressive power.

Table of Contents:
INTRODUCTION xxi CHAPTER 1: INTRODUCING DRUPAL 1 CHAPTER 2: INSTALLING DRUPAL 9 CHAPTER 3: YOUR FIRST DRUPAL WEBSITE 27 CHAPTER 4: ADMINISTRATION CONFIGURATION, MODULES, AND REPORTING 49 CHAPTER 5: ADMINISTRATION BLOCKS, MENUS, AND THEMES 69 CHAPTER 6: CONTENT 91 CHAPTER 7: USER MANAGEMENT 125 CHAPTER 8: TAXONOMY 157 CHAPTER 9: SEARCH, PERFORMANCE, STATISTICS, AND REPORTING 173 CHAPTER 10: TRIGGERS, ACTIONS, WORKFLOW, AND RULES 189 CHAPTER 11: VIEWS 213 CHAPTER 12: INTERNATIONALIZATION 241 CHAPTER 13: THEMING 263 CHAPTER 14: CONTRIBUTED MODULES 299 CHAPTER 15: CUSTOM MODULES 315 CHAPTER 16: DEVELOPMENT HOOKS 331 CHAPTER 17: MODULE DEVELOPMENT START TO FINISH 347 CHAPTER 18: ADVANCED DRUPAL INSTALLATIONS 379 CHAPTER 19: PREFLIGHT CHECKLIST 401 APPENDIX: EXERCISES AND ANSWERS 417 INDEX 433

About the Author :
Jacob Redding is an open source evangelist and technologist, and an active member in the Drupal community. In addition to managing several modules on drupal.org and providing Drupal-related training and consulting, he is also a board member on the Drupal Association.
